Laser-cutting molding technology
The content of laser cutting processing technology can be roughly combed as follows: laser removal, such as laser drilling, etc.; Laser connection; Such as metal laser welding machine; Laser surface modification materials, such as laser quenching and tempering treatment (laser hardening primer, laser remelting, laser cladding); Laser production and manufacturing of new materials, such as laser calcination, laser preparation of polymer materials; Laser parts processing, such as laser parts rapid prototyping technology production and processing.
Main equipment and introduction: Rapid prototyping and laser cutting training room have 3D printing machine tools and laser cutting machine tools. The laser cutting machine uses laser principle technology to process parts, and 3D printing uses rapid prototyping methods to complete product design and sample processing, which greatly improves the speed of trial production of new products and product replacement efficiency.
Among them, are laser cutting processing connection, laser surface modification materials, laser manufacturing new materials, and laser parts internal organizational structure transformation. It should be emphasized that some processing methods are not only surface-modified materials but also towards the rapid production of metal parts by laser. That's what laser cladding means, for example.
